Choosing the correct ice melting salt requires knowing your specific needs and the technical aspects behind the materials. Various ice melters function the same in very low temperatures, and various products can damage concrete or get more info landscaping if not applied properly. You should choose a material that becomes effective fast, maintains effectiveness at low temperatures, and distributes uniformly for even coverage. Calcium chloride, magnesium chloride, and treated rock salts each offer distinct characteristics—calcium chloride, as an example, dissolves ice at significantly colder temperatures and generates an exothermic reaction, generating its own heat. This means, even in temperatures below zero, salt application can dissolve the ice bond and provide enhanced traction.
Successful winter safety requires a proactive strategy. Apply salt preventively instead of waiting for snow buildup. Preventive salt application stops ice from bonding to surfaces, resulting in easier cleanup and lower salt requirements. This strategy saves money while protecting the environment, decreasing salt contamination in surrounding water bodies. The correct storage and handling of salt is crucial to winter safety. Store your salt in a dry, covered location to avoid clumping that affects even distribution. Always use calibrated spreaders to apply the correct amount—overuse wastes product and can damage pavement and vegetation, while using too little results in dangerous surface conditions. Is Ice Melting Salt Safe for Pets and Children
While using ice melting salt, you should prioritize pet safety and child protection. Certain ice melters may cause irritation to paws and skin and could be dangerous when swallowed. Choose products labeled as family-friendly to lower potential hazards. Always follow the manufacturer's instructions, use only the necessary amount, and keep salt in a secure location. Clean walkways and clean pet paws after exposure to reduce any potential hazards and protect your loved ones.

Does Ice Melt Salt Lose Its Effectiveness Over Time
A common question is if ice melting salt has an expiration date. Given its high chemical stability, ice melting salt typically lasts for many years and won't actually expire. However, incorrect storage methods—like contact with moisture—can cause clustering, reducing ease of application but not the salt's ice-fighting capability. To keep it working at its best, you should maintain it in a moisture-proof, sealed container, so you'll always have the most effective solution for managing ice.
Does Ice Melting Salt Damage Concrete or Pavement?
Consider ice melt repeatedly hitting your concrete—yes, winter treatments will cause concrete corrosion through continued exposure. When you spread salt, you're speeding up surface wear, particularly on aging or permeable surfaces. Salt infiltrates existing damage, increases temperature-related stress, and can break down structural bonds. To preserve your surfaces, select gentle ice-melting alternatives and always follow application instructions precisely. Surface treatment provides additional protection and extends pavement lifespan.
Can You Find Green Solutions for Ice Melting?
Yes, you'll find eco friendly options to traditional ice melting salt. Consider using biodegradable de icers formulated with materials like calcium magnesium acetate or potassium acetate. These products break down naturally, minimizing harm to vegetation, earth, and water systems. You can locate solutions that deliver effective ice control while limiting environmental impact. When selecting, always check product labels for environmental certifications and application guidelines to guarantee you're using the most environmentally responsible solution.
